Wiz Khalifa Not Aware Of Taylor Swift's 'Shake It Off'
. (Radio.com) Wiz Khalifa has been going through a messy divorce, so forgive him if he's not up to speed with the times. While on the Tonight Show, Wiz let it slip that he might have missed a major pop culture moment: Taylor Swift's ubiquitous 1989 lead single, "Shake It Off." Khalifa was summoned to a game of Catchphrase along with Miles Teller and Jim Persons, and played surprisingly well, until he couldn't name Swift's hit. When Teller leads with, "It's a Taylor Swift song," Wiz's jaw completely dropped. The Whiplash star fed him cues like "The last word's not on but�" but Wiz, who guessed off, still couldn't figure it out. Fallon said, "Just name 10 Taylor Swift songs," and Khalifa gave the greatest shrug since Kanye's infamous one at the 2009 VMAs. Read more here.
